About Chattooga County Division of Family and Children Services Food Stamp Office
The Chattooga County Division of Family and Children Services Food Stamp Office, located in Summerville, GA, administers the federal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) for Summerville residents. Often called "food stamps," SNAP benefits provide nutrition assistance for income-eligible households. The U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) oversees the SNAP program, and SNAP Offices distribute benefits to Summerville residents. The program reduces food insecurity and poverty by providing supplemental nutrition assistance for low-income households.
